Responsibilities
- Plan and facilitate appropriate MT sessions
- Complete session notes within company expectations
- Submit invoicing by company deadlines
- Strong communication skills with team and supervisors
-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in Music Therapy from an AMTA-approved program
- Board Certification (MT-BC) required
- Strong musicianship and the ability to use a variety of instruments and vocal techniques in sessions
- Demonstrated ability to engage and motivate clients through evidence-based and individualized interventions
- Experience working with neurodiverse populations, individuals with disabilities, or behavioral health needs preferred
- Reliable transportation and ability to travel for community-based sessions
Rate: $45/hr, mileage reimbursement, flexible schedule
